Para você que está procurando como mostrar últimas postagens no WordPress e não acha um plugin ou código adequado, veja como fazer de maneira simples.
- Como fazer o redirecionamento via htaccess em seu website?
- Veja como desabilitar atualizações no WordPress
- Como mostrar as últimas postagens no seu site em WordPress
A exibição de postagens recentes ajuda seus usuários a encontrá-las facilmente. Você pode adicionar postagens recentes no artigo ou em sua barra lateral, após o final do conteúdo da postagem, dentro do conteúdo da postagem com um código de acesso, nas áreas de widget do rodapé e basicamente em qualquer outro lugar que desejar.
É possível exibir artigos recentes no WordPress com um plug-in, widget, código de acesso e o método manual com a função de postagem recente.
Mostrar as últimas postagens Usando o widget
Como opção, as novas versões do WordPress vem com um widget padrão embutido para exibir postagens recentes dentro do artigo adicionando blocos, posts mais recentes.
Na barra lateral, é possível acessando o administrador do WordPress, acessar em seguida Aparência, Widgets e adicionar o widget Posts Recentes a uma barra lateral.
Mostrar as últimas postagens usando o widget É possível fornecer um título alternativo para o widget lateral, mostrar a data e número de postagens que deseja exibir. Em seguida, Só clicar em Salvar.
Mostrar as últimas postagens usando plugins
Como a opção de widget é bastante limitada e nem permite exibir imagens ou trechos, o que geralmente é uma boa opção para os usuários, existe opção boa de plugins.
Alguns plugins são bem úteis para mostrar as últimas postagens de maneira que você pode configurá-la do seu jeito. O mais conhecido é o Recent Posts Widget Extended, podendo baixar neste link.
Basta instalar e ativar o plugin, em seguida, basta acessar Aparência, Widgets e adicionar o widget Posts recentes estendidos a uma barra lateral.
O plugin oferece controle total para você mostrar as últimas postagens no WordPress, como exibir miniaturas, trechos, limitar categorias e tags, ignorar postagens persistentes e muito mais.
É possível também usar o widget para exibir postagens recentes de qualquer outro tipo de artigo
Mostrar as últimas postagens usando código
Tem também a opção de utilizar códigos para adicionar artigos recentes a uma barra lateral, e é bastante simples.
Para inserir alguns códigos no WordPress você precisa fazer é instalar e ativar o plugin Display Shortcode. Não precisa de configurações extras.
Edite um Artigo ou página na qual deseja exibir as recentes exibindo o código [display-posts] com parâmetros que vamos mostrar a seguir.
Mostrar 5 artigos recentes com miniaturas e trecho
[display-posts posts_per_page="5" image_size="thumbnail" include_excerpt="true"]
Mostrar páginas recentes ao invés de postagens
[display-posts posts_per_page="5" post_type="page"]
Alterar a ordem para título em vez de data
[display-posts posts_per_page="5" orderby="title"]
Exibir páginas recentes em uma página mãe específica
[display-posts posts_per_page="5" post_type="page" post_parent="5"]
O plugin oferece uma lista completa de parâmetros na documentação.
É possível habilitar essa função no seu WordPress e utilizar esses códigos de acesso em um simples widget de texto adicionando o código ao arquivo functions.php do tema que você usa.
add_filter('widget_text', 'do_shortcode');
Mostrar as últimas postagens adicionando código manualmente
Essa opção é para usuários mais avançados do WordPress, que querem adicionar postagens recentes diretamente em arquivos de tema do WordPress.
Você vai encontrar na internet diversas maneiras de fazer isso, mas a mais fácil é usando a classe WP_Query interna. Basta adicionar este código onde deseja mostrar as últimas postagens.
<ul>
// Define os parâmetros de WP Query
<?php $the_query = new WP_Query( 'posts_per_page=5' ); ?>
// Início WP Query
<?php while ($the_query -> have_posts()) : $the_query -> the_post(); ?>
// Exibe o título do artigo com Hyperlink
<li><a href="<?php the_permalink() ?>"><?php the_title(); ?></a></li>
// Mostra o Artigo
<li><?php the_excerpt(__('(more…)')); ?></li>
// Repita o processo e redefina quando atingir o limite
<?php
endwhile;
wp_reset_postdata();
?>
</ul>
O código simplesmente exibe as cinco postagens mais recentes com seu título e trecho. A classe WP_Query possui vários parâmetros que permitem personalizá-la da maneira que você preferir. Consulte o Codex para mais informações.
Essas e outras dicas é possível você encontrar em minhas dicas favoritas que nenhum outro local você vai encontrar, são experiências que eu tive e publiquei.
Deixe nos comentários qualquer dúvida ou sugestão.